The European Union has fully implemented its long-awaited Entry/Exit System (EES), marking a major transformation in border management across the Schengen Area. The system is now operational in 29 participating countries, replacing traditional passport stamping with advanced biometric registration for non-EU travellers.
According to the European Commission, the EES is designed to modernise border control procedures, improve security, and streamline the movement of travellers entering and leaving Europe. The rollout represents one of the most significant upgrades to the region’s border infrastructure in recent years.

The Entry/Exit System is a digital border management platform that records the movements of non-European Union travellers entering and exiting the Schengen Area. Instead of manual passport stamps, the system collects biometric data, including fingerprints and facial images, alongside travel details such as entry and exit dates.
This information is stored securely and used to monitor compliance with visa rules, including the duration of stay permitted within the Schengen Zone. By automating these processes, the system aims to reduce human error and improve the accuracy of border control operations.

The EES applies to travellers visiting countries such as France, Germany, Spain, and Italy, among others within the Schengen framework.
The introduction of the EES is part of the European Union’s broader strategy to enhance border security while facilitating smoother travel. With increasing numbers of international visitors, traditional passport stamping methods were becoming less efficient and more prone to delays.
By adopting biometric technology, authorities can process travellers more quickly and accurately. The system also strengthens security by providing reliable identification and reducing the risk of identity fraud.
Officials from the eu-LISA, which oversees large-scale IT systems for border management, have highlighted that the EES supports both security and efficiency objectives, ensuring that Europe remains open yet well-regulated.
When non-EU travellers arrive at a Schengen border, they are required to provide biometric data, including fingerprints and a facial scan. This process typically takes place at automated kiosks or designated border control points.
The system then records the traveller’s entry details and calculates the permitted duration of stay. Upon departure, the exit is logged, allowing authorities to track compliance with visa regulations.
For frequent travellers, previously recorded biometric data can be reused, reducing processing time on subsequent visits. This creates a more seamless experience for those who travel regularly to Europe.
For travellers, the most noticeable change is the elimination of passport stamps. Instead, entry and exit records are maintained digitally, providing a more efficient and modern travel experience.
While the initial registration may take slightly longer due to biometric data collection, subsequent journeys are expected to be faster. Automated systems and digital records reduce the need for manual checks, helping to minimise queues at border crossings.
Travellers are advised to ensure that their documents are valid and to follow instructions provided at border control points to avoid delays.
The EES offers several advantages for both travellers and authorities. For governments, it enhances border security by providing accurate and real-time data on traveller movements. This helps identify overstays and ensures compliance with visa rules.
For travellers, the system improves efficiency and reduces the reliance on paper-based processes. It also supports the development of automated border control systems, which can significantly shorten waiting times.
In addition, the use of biometric data ensures a higher level of accuracy in identity verification, contributing to safer and more reliable travel.
Despite its benefits, the implementation of the EES has raised some concerns. Privacy and data protection are key issues, as the system involves the collection and storage of biometric information.
EU authorities have emphasised that strict data protection regulations are in place to safeguard personal information and ensure compliance with privacy laws. Travellers can expect their data to be handled securely and used only for authorised purposes.
Another challenge is the initial adjustment period, as both travellers and border authorities adapt to the new system. Training, infrastructure upgrades, and public awareness campaigns are essential to ensure a smooth transition.
The full activation of the Entry/Exit System signals a shift toward digital and automated border management in Europe. By replacing traditional methods with advanced technology, the EU is positioning itself at the forefront of modern travel systems.
As international travel continues to grow, such innovations will play a crucial role in balancing efficiency with security. The EES is expected to pave the way for further developments, including the integration of additional digital travel authorisation systems.
Overall, the new system represents a significant step forward in creating a more streamlined, secure, and traveller-friendly border experience across the Schengen Area.
